Objectives: The 2007 Korea National Survey for Environmental Pollutants in the Human Body found the highest blood mercury levels nationwide among residents in Seoksan-ri, Goro-myeon, Gunwi-gun, Gyeonsangbuk-do. With the aim to reduce the blood mercury levels of residents in this region, we conducted this study to identify the association between mercury exposure levels and shark meat consumption. Methods: This survey was conducted with 118 participants in Seoksan-ri before the Chuseok festival and 113 residents were added afterwards. Information on participants was collected via questionnaires. Total mercury concentrations in biological samples were measured using a mercury analyzer with the gold-amalgam collection method. Results: To identify this, we conducted mercury exposure level analysis before and after the Chuseok festival and found that blood and urinary mercury levels after Chuseok (GM of $6.9{\mu}g/L$ in blood and $1.68{\mu}g/g$_cr in urine) were higher than those before (GM of $5.29{\mu}g/L$ in blood and $1.44{\mu}g/g$_cr in urine). This area maintains a custom of using shark meat as one of the ancestral rite foods, and the performance of such rites and shark meat consumption have been identified as main sources of mercury exposure. Other than this, smoking, dental amalgam treatment and residential period in the area also contributed to an increase in mercury exposure levels. On the other hand, recent consumption of oriental medicine and vaccination did not have a significant influence on mercury levels. Conclusion: The results were attributed to the local custom of consuming shark meat with high mercury concentrations during rituals taking place during the festival and ancestral rites. Given that the blood mercury levels in 23.2% of the residents exceeded the HBM II values recommended by the German Commission on Human Biological Monitoring, it is suggested that further appropriate actions and follow-up measures be taken to reduce the mercury exposure levels of the residents that exceeded the reference values.
TV news anchor woman's appearance, voice, expression, and clothing, etc., have an influence on the reliability of the article to be reported. Among these, clothing is the most crucial factor in forming an anchor woman's image, especially the clothing color factor. This study is aimed at providing the basic foundation for anchor woman when they select the clothing color by analyzing the clothing color image on the screen. For this purpose, the KBS and MBC 9 o'clock news desk and SBS 8 o'clock news of the local major news programs were selected. With the collection of 300 pieces of news clips related to anchor woman's clothing from January to December 2008, they were classified into F/W seasons and analyzed by the clothing color. The surveying method of clothing color was to capture the anchor woman's clothing among the news clips, then pick the representing color by applying Adobe Photoshop, and researching the formed $L^*a^*b^*$ value of color chips. The surveyed color was transformed into value of distant cell, H V/C, and the results were analyzed. As a result, it showed that the White system for anchor woman's clothing during the S/S seasons is most frequently picked, followed by the Red system. In F/W seasons, Gray system is the most favored, then White and Red, respectively. It was revealed that the most frequently selected colors for upper-wear by anchor women in the three broadcasting stations was an achromatic color, such as White or Gray, and then the chromatic color, Red. It shows that there is no big difference in season. The Inner-wear color matched the jackets which were also achromatic in color, white and black being the most favored in the S/S seasons, and in the case of chromatic colors, Red was the most favored. In addition to this, identical coloration with jacket, coloration with similar color, or single color as clothing color were no less frequently adopted. During the F/W seasons, identical coloration accounts for 26%, the most popular colored being White and Red. It was found that the coloration with achromatic colors are highly favored in the three major broadcasting stations alike.
Objectives : Peripheral blood-buffy coat fractions (N=14,956) have been stored at $-70^{\circ}C$ in the headquarter of the Korean Multicenter Cancer Cohort (KMCC), since 1993. To study the future molecular etiology of cancers using specimens of the cohort, properly stored specimens are necessary, Therefore, the DNA-viability of the bully coat samples was investigated. Methods : Buffy coat fraction samples were randomly selected from various collection areas and years (N=100). The DNA viability was evaluate from the UV-absorbent ratios at 260/280nm and the PCH for $\beta$-globin was performed with genomic DNA isolated from the buffy coat. Results : PCR products were obtained from 85 and 98% of the C and H area-samples, respectively, using 50 or $100{\mu}l$ of the buffy coat. There were significant differences in the yields of the PCR-amplifications from the C and H areas (p<0.05), which was due to differences in the homogenization of the buffy coat fractions available as aliquots. The PCR-products were obtained from all of the samples (N=7) stored at the C area-local confer, but the other aliquots stored at the headquarter were not PCR-amplified, Therefore, the PCR products in almost all the samples, even including the DNA-degraded samples, were obtained. In addition, an improvement in the DNA isolation, i,e. approx. 1.6 fold, was found after using extra RBC lysis buffer. Conclusions : PCR products for $\beta$-globin were obtained from nearly all of the samples. The regional differences in the PCR amplifications were thought to have originated from the different sample-preparation and homogenization performance. Therefore, the long term-stored buffy coat species at the KMCC can be used for future molecular studies.
This study were carried out to evaluate the possibility of nuclear progression of canine immature oocytes, of which was cultured in a reproductive tract, such as oviduct, ovarian bursa and uterus of estrus bitch for 4, 5 and 6 days following immediately collection. Cumulus intact oocytes(COC) fore collected from domestic dog following ovariohysterectomy at local veterinary clinics. In Exp. 1, COCs $of>110\;{\mu}m$ diameter were selected and cultured in vitro at $39^{\circ}C$, $5\%\;CO\_{2} $ in air atmosphere. The nuclear progression of canine oocytes checked at 24, 48 or 72 h after in vitro maturation. There was not increased the nuclear progression to the M II stage depending on culture periods at 24, 48 and 72h $(1.3\%,\;3.7\%\;and\;4.7\%)$. In Exp. 2, to evaluate of nuclear progression of immature oocytes, collected or in vitro cultured oocytes were transfer into a canine reproductive tract (oviduct, ovarian bursa and uterus). The recovery rates of canine oocytes from a reproductive tract after 4 days $(33.7\%)$ in vivo culture were significantly higher than those 5 $(17.7\%)$ 6 day $(3.4\%)$ (P<0.05). The survival rates of collected oocytes after 4 days $(60.0\%)$ were also significantly higher than those of 5 days $(30.2\%)$ and 6 days $(38.9\%)$ (P<0.05). The meiotic resumption rates of canine oocytes were not significantly difference among the culture periods at 4 days $(5.9\%)$, 5 days $(0.0\%)$ and 6 days $(0.0\%)$. These results show that the nuclear progression of canine immature oocytes from in in vivo culture was not affect the nuclear resumption of oocytes.

With the 91 lines of Italian millet collected throughout the whole country in Korea and the 238 varieties from several Asian countries, trial was carried out to elucidate its differentiation, dissemination and distribution, and the ethnobotanical relations to the adjacent area. Glutinous millets which consisted of 66% among the collected Korean lines were widely distributed throughout the whole country, but non-glutinous ones were mainly distributed in the mountainous regions and Jeju island. The variations in germinability at low temperature were recognized among lines, but seemed not to be closely related to their regional distribution. The collected lines with small grain size were distributed mainly in the mountainous regions of middle and northern part of Korea and larger ones in Jeonnam province and Jeju island. And some of them were larger in grain size as compared with that of Japanese and Republic of China varieties. Seed coat color of collected lines in Korea showed wide variations from yellow to gray, especially in Gyungbuk province. However, all lines from Chungnam, Jeonnam and Gyungnam province were yellow in seed coat color. All lines from Korean collection except two lines indicated negative(-) phenol reaction which is very similar to that of Japan and China, while these were quite different from the varieties of Republic of China, Philippines and India, of which 30-60% showed positive(+) phenol reaction. The pattern of the esterase isozyme m Korean lines was simillar to that of Japanese lines and this was quite different from that of Republic of China, Philippines and India. Variation of this trait was greater in Chinese and Korean lines.
This research aims to investigate the cause of the occurrence of a weak road drainage section scientifically and specifically through a site survey for a poorly drained section occurring due to rainfalls during road operation. This paper deeply reviewed the existing research results and current situation data on the poorly drained sections accumulated in Korea Expressway Corporation in order to investigate the cause of the occurrence of a weak road drainage section, and deeply verified and analyzed the weak sections for the road surface drainage facilities and the other road drainage facilities by visiting the expressway controlled by the 6 local headquarters and 33 branches of Korea Expressway Corporation. As a result of site surveys for the weak road drainage sections, i) in a road surface section, occurrence of ponding in the road shoulder pavement due to slope changes, bad collection of water in the collecting well at a median strip, shortage of road shoulder dike height, and inferior construction, etc. was analyzed to be the main cause of the occurrence of poorly drained sections, and ii) in a road neighborhood section, the occurrence of pavement height difference in a main road and shoulder section due to inferior ditches on a slope and the bad drain age at the inlet and outlet of a culvert due to soil deposits, debris, etc. were analyzed to be the main cause of the occurrence of weak sections. Proposed as a plan to improve the poorly drainage section of road were i)calculation of capacity through material changes at the ditch, enhancement of vertical sections and hydraulic analysis in terms of construction and other aspects, ii)derivation of a combined slope considering a slope and a vertical linearity and maintenance of proper distance between drainage structures in a vertical concave section in terms of geometrical structure, and iii)calculation of the drainage facility installation interval using a minutely rainfall intensity formula and a non-uniform flow analysis technique in terms of hydraulics and hydrologics and prompt removal of rainfalls from the road surface according to a linear drainage method.

A comprehensive collection of proteins senses local changes in intracellular $Ca^{2+}$ concentrations ($[Ca^{2+}]_i$) and transduces these signals into responses to agonists. In the present study, we examined the effect of sphingosine-1-phosphate (S1P) on modulation of intracellular $Ca^{2+}$ concentrations in cat esophageal smooth muscle cells. To measure $[Ca^{2+}]_i$ levels in cat esophageal smooth muscle cells, we used a fluorescence microscopy with the Fura-2 loading method. S1P produced a concentration-dependent increase in $[Ca^{2+}]_i$ in the cells. Pretreatment with EGTA, an extracellular $Ca^{2+}$ chelator, decreased the S1P-induced increase in $[Ca^{2+}]_i$, and an L-type $Ca^{2+}$-channel blocker, nimodipine, decreased the effect of S1P. This indicates that $Ca^{2+}$ influx may be required for muscle contraction by S1P. When stimulated with thapsigargin, an intracellular calcium chelator, or 2-Aminoethoxydiphenyl borate (2-APB), an $InsP_3$ receptor blocker, the S1P-evoked increase in $[Ca^{2+}]_i$ was significantly decreased. Treatment with pertussis toxin (PTX), an inhibitor of $G_i$-protein, suppressed the increase in $[Ca^{2+}]_i$ evoked by S1P. These results suggest that the S1P-induced increase in $[Ca^{2+}]_i$ in cat esophageal smooth muscle cells occurs upon the activation of phospholipase C and subsequent release of $Ca^{2+}$ from the $InsP_3$-sensitive $Ca^{2+}$ pool in the sarcoplasmic reticulum. These results suggest that S1P utilized extracellular $Ca^{2+}$ via the L type $Ca^{2+}$ channel, which was dependent on activation of the $S1P_4$ receptor coupled to PTX-sensitive $G_i$ protein, via phospholipase C-mediated $Ca^{2+}$ release from the $InsP_3$-sensitive $Ca^{2+}$ pool in cat esophageal smooth muscle cells.

Purpose: Epitheliod sarcoma is an obscure clinical entity. This study analyzes the correlation between the clinical course and the AJCC stage, presence of residual tumor and ezrin-expression. Materials and Methods: Twenty-three cases of epithelioid sarcoma were eligible. All the cases had operation. Fifteen cases had systemic chemotherapy and 6 cases had adjuvant radiotherapy. Immumohistochemical analysis was done for 15 cases. Analyzed factors were initial stage, adjuvant treatment, local recurrence, residual tumor immumohistochemical results and surgical margin. Results: The event free survival rate of 15 stage II, III cases was 47.4% at 129 months. The actual survival rate of 8 stage IV cases was 37.5% at 80 months. The presence of residual tumor tissue on re-excision specimen showed statistical significance on event free survival rate(P=0.03). Adjuvant therapy showed no impact on outcome. The stage IV and locally recurrent cases had a positive relation with Ezrin-positivity. Conclusion: Residual tumor showed correlation in the outcome of epitheliod sarcoma. Chemotherapy and radiation therapy did not affect the outcome. Further case collection and analysis is needed for the significance between Ezrin expression and clinical behavior.
This study was intended to assess the need of home nursing care and analyze the effect of home nursing care, and find out the problems during the performance of home nursing care for the chronic patients among the low-income people in urban area. Data collection by interview was carried out from Nov. 1991 to Jul. 1992. The main results were as follows; 1) Total subjects for the need assessment of home nursing care were 123 households wi th 488 persons in a urban poor area. Over half of households $(57.7\%)$ was teenage family. The overall living conditions were poor and the average monthly income was 580 thousands won. $74.8\%$ of subjects was covered by medical care insurance and only $4.7\%$ was covered by public assistance. The morbidity rate was $8.2\%$ among 488 subjects and $27.5\%$ of them was not treated at all, $30\%$ was treated in utilizing pharmacies or local clinics. 2) The subjects of home nursing care were 46 with Hypertension or DM who agreeded the participation of study among registered patients at a public health center in Incheon. Home visiting was performed at intervals per one month for one year. Most of them were the elder(mean age=61 years) and long term patients(7.8 years continued). Home nursing care was effective. That is, blood pressure(including systolic and diastolic pressure) was significantly reduced (t(n=22)=2.31, P=.031, t(n=24)=4.16, P=.000 respectively) and knowledge of disease(t(N=46)=-7.63, P=.000), attitude of disease (t(N =46) = -4.92, P=.000), and self-care(t(N =46) = -4.89, P= .000) were significantly improved through home nursing care. But there was no difference in blood sugar for diabetics between the beginning and the end of visits. At the beginning of visit for home nursing care, sex$(\beta=-0414,\;t=-3.012)$ and nursing need({3=.310, t=2.164) were influencing self-care, and duration of disease$(\beta=.297,\;t=2.106)$ and nursing need $(\beta=.385, t=20417)$ were influencing blood pressure, blood sugar level. Namely, the subjects who were male and had higher nursing need showed better self-care and the longer duration of disease and the higher nursing need were relationship with the better blood pressure and blood sugar level. At the end of visit for home nursing care after one year, the blood pressure and blood sugar level was influenced by age $(\beta.320,\;t= 2.242)$, duration of disease ($(\beta.352,\;t= 2.395)$ and nursing need $(\beta=.350,\;t=2.623)$ and self-care had no influencing factor. The higher age and the longer duration of disease and the higher nursing need were relationship with the better blood pressure and blood sugar level. 3) The problems that were found out during the performance of home nursing care were the absent of useful protocols for services and the clear evaluation base, and the difficulty of teaching elders who were the major part of our subjects.
